Jagger, the sitcom star?

Mick 'in talks' over US comedy

Mick Jagger is set to appear in a pivotal role in a new American sitcom.

The rock star is reportedly in negotiations over the appearance in a still-untitled series for the ABC network.

The show will revolve around a group of New York blue-collar workers who decide to rob a celebrity, which is where Jagger comes in.

The show was originally titled I Want to Rob Jeff Goldblum, even though Goldblum was never going to be part of it.

Now, the Hollywood Reporter reveals that Jagger has been approached for the key role.

He would only appear in a few scenes, and his name is not expected to be in the title, but he is crucial to the plotline as the target of the planned robbery.

He is mentioned numerous times in the scenes that already have been filmed, the trade paper reports.

If Jagger does sign on, he will join Elton John in working on an ABC comedy. John’s show Him And Us is currently in the pilot stage.
